Transaction 5db69ebac73e502cc87938ec59f188588a163863e38799281821f152e3b3a165

1 Input
2 Outputs
  • 5db69ebac73e502cc87938ec59f188588a163863e38799281821f152e3b3a165:0
  • value  7895871
    address  3LrSVMFDc9NtTwJUtNhiMAvvszQDXCsBMg
  • 5db69ebac73e502cc87938ec59f188588a163863e38799281821f152e3b3a165:1
  • value  1189415053
    address  363ufsvzZ6e5xrtvd8UKdaVHcfCCBwcRsL